Probiotics
Market Overview:
Probiotic ingredients stimulate the natural digestive juices and
enzymes in the body that ensure proper functioning of the digestive system and
can be administered through food or in the form of supplements, which is a more
common choice.Growing demand for probiotic dietary supplements and
nutrient-rich supplements for animals can promise the growth of the market for
probiotics in the near future. They are a major driving force within the
booming digestive health supplement category and are being consumed by people
of all age groups.
The food & beverage segment dominated the probiotics market,
on the basis of its application. Apart from this other application include
cosmetics, pharma etc. The demand for liquid probiotics has increased as
compared to dry probiotics, due to its application in yogurt, which is the most
popular source of probiotics for its easy availability and taste.
Probiotics Market Growth Drivers
and Restraints:
Other products that use liquid probiotics include probiotic
juices, kefir water and yogurt-based drinks, which are healthy options for
daily supplementation. Probiotic supplements represent the largest
condition-specific category for mass-market retail sales in the United States,
and the second-fastest growing condition-specific supplement category whose
awareness has led to a major boost in the market. This shows the importance and
awareness among people for probiotic supplements.
Today, probiotics are moving beyond digestive health to immunity,
feminine health, oral health, skin health, weight control and diabetes,
cognitive health, sport endurance, and gut-brain axis, gut-muscle axis and
cardiovascular health. Their benefits are proving to be one of the most
versatile ingredients of all times and are now being used in fermented beauty
products enriched with nutrients and other ingredients, such as probiotics, antioxidants,
vitamins, are trending in the market. This in turn is driving the probiotics market growth.
Probiotics Market
Geographical Segmentation:
Asia Pacific is projected to be a key market for yogurt in the
coming years. China holds a huge opportunity for both domestic and
international companies to penetrate the yogurt market as the consumption of
yoghurt is on a large scale.
North America and Europe are huge markets for probiotics owing to
the ban on the usage of antibiotics in animal feed in several European and
North American countries, increasing product innovations in the form of
chocolates, biscuits & others, increasing demand of probiotic based medicines
due to proven positive results for reducing risk of chronic diseases such as
diarrhoea & bowel diseases related to antibiotic use and rising demand for
fermented food in daily diet.
